About The Position

The Department of Emergency Management is responsible for leading disaster and emergency planning, preparedness, response and recovery activities on behalf of the Province of Nova Scotia. Its objective is to ensure Nova Scotians are safe, prepared, and resilient in the face of disasters and emergencies. The Department coordinates partners and resources during provincial-level critical incidents, supports municipal and regional events, administers 911 service, maintains critical communications infrastructure, and supports regional emergency management centres. It also ensures critical government services continue during and after critical events. The Regional Operations and Infrastructure Branch enhances provincial safety and resilience by strengthening critical communications infrastructure through the Public Safety Field Communications Agency, establishing and maintaining 6 Regional Emergency Operations Centres (REOCs), coordinating regional emergencies, strengthening local and regional emergency preparedness through outreach, fostering collaboration with regional partners, and providing real-time situational awareness to the Provincial Coordination Centre. The Public Safety Field Communications Agency manages public safety and public works two-way radio communications, infrastructure, and dispatch services for the Province. The Agency is seeking a Client Relations Officer (CRO) to be the primary point of contact for user requests related to the trunked mobile radio system. The CRO will receive client requests, determine necessary resources and information, and act as a project lead, managing requests from start to completion. This role involves building and leveraging professional relationships to effectively manage workflows.

Responsibilities

  • Set up and lead projects, and act as a liaison between users and the technical and operational subject matter experts in-house and within the vendor community, as needed to address those requests. Activities include project scope development, business requirements analysis, managing project resources and timelines, and coaching the project team to ensure effective project delivery.
  • Ensure the timely completion of client requests, ranging from routine to complex, multi-month projects.
  • Become familiar with vendor and client contracts supporting the environment and, working closely with the TMR2 Contract Officer, support the development and processing of contract change requests and work orders as needed to fulfill requests.
  • Monitors the operational environment and identifies needs and shortcomings, resulting in client needs not being met. Works to generate strategic alignment between the activities and goals of the Agency and the activities of client agencies. Seeks synergies and opportunities for cooperation or shared service delivery.
  • Prepares and communicates cost estimates for projects and helps client agencies develop business cases where needed.
  • Acts as a knowledgeable consultant to support clients and partner agencies through questions and challenges related to radio communications and associated technologies.
  • Support procurement activities to meet client requests for new technology.
  • Tracks and documents processes, identifies shortcomings and suggests improvements to current processes.
  • Monitors project budgets, works with the finance team to ensure accurate billing and manage/communicate any variances.
  • Manages day-to-day relationships with clients, service providers, and project teams.
  • Evaluates project performance and outcomes.
  • Champions the resolution of problems on behalf of clients or project teams.
